So first of all, Dark Shadows is on archive.org library (so is Xena Warrior Princess)
Second of all, i started it. Getting gothic horror vibes. Victoria Winters is a perfect name. Ive never seen a soap opera older than the 90s so im curious of this writing steucture. Im also used to shows older than 90s having few character arcs or long term plots, as ive only seen old sci fi shows that were pretty much self contained stories with at most small background character arcs. So curious if the plot will be more involved since its long running and can manage to have the time for it. It gives off Twin Peaks energy so i think maybe twin peaks was a kind of evolution of this type of show - drama, gothic, surreal, unsettling, mysterious small town full of secrets.
